Since they came to limelight in 2002 as winners of Star Quest sponsored by STAR they have not relented in churning out hit after hit.
The duo of Kingsley Okonkwo (KC) and Precious John (Presh) just released their third album entitled "No Time: Everything Sengemenge" under their independent label KP Records.
Their career has been on an upward swing. |

Weird MC, aka Da Rappatainer, is Africa's First Lady of hip hop.
She divides her time between London, England and Lagos, Nigeria, and her music reflects that: it's a hybrid of hip hop/afrobeat/R & B and more! In other words her style mixes the hard urban style of London with African rhythms and melodies.
Weird MC was born in London and grew up partly there and partly in Lagos so she identifies with, and has been influenced by, the music of both places. She says her main musical influences are Fela Kuti, Lauryn Hill, Miriam Makeba, Jimi Hendrix and others.
On stage Weird MC has performed with Femi Kuti, Tony Allen and Lágbájá and has toured extensively, including being a major attraction at WOMEX and at the All Africa Games in Nigeria in 2003. She is very well known in Nigeria and is part and parcel of the Afrobeat and hip hop scene in London, regularly performing at venues such as Cargo in London. She is equally at home with her own band or with a smaller crew and DJ.
Concerning Weird MC's specific songs, these include the smash hit 'Allen Avenue', the anthemic 'African Woman', 'Ijoya' (meaning 'Time to Dance' in Yoruba), 'Palava' and 'What are you waiting for?'.
Weird MC not only is a lyricist and performer, she is a programmer and producer having taken music technology and music production courses in London.
Finally, how did she come to be called Weird MC? She used to be in a 6-member group called the Weirdoes so she took out the 'o' and added MC: hers is a name and a sound that definitely turns heads! |

Sound Sultan a graduate of geography and regional planning from lagos state university .Made an enterance into the Nigerian music industry in the year 2000 with a single called mathematics ,it was a statement that a new style had
come into the nigerian music scene .He went ahead to release his 1st album Kppsshew ,that won him 9 awards
including best song writer ,best new act and song of the year .
Sultan released a follow up album in the year 2003 that firmly rooted his stand as a Nigerian advocate with the single Motherland that won recognition ,and the hearts of people in Nigeria and beyong the shores . In 2004 , Sound Sultan was invited into the studios by the Grammy Award winning Wyclef Jean to record a song on the Legends album released in the united states and world wide . In 2007 Sound sultan released his 3rd Album and celebrated his 7th year on the 7/7/7 with support from all the recognisable artistes in the nation .In the year 2008 sound sultan released his 4th Album SS4 that features the likes of 2Face,Lord of Ajasa,J/anna ,w4, 9ice, Lambo , Kel , Excel , Strings and
Wyclef jean in a song called King of My Country" to be released in the United States and the U.K as a sound track to
a film . Sound Sultan has also ventured into the world of fashion has his NAija Ninja clothing has been featured for 2
straight years in the prestigous Nigerian Fashion Week.
Sound Sultan is also a prolific song writer that has written for a number of artiste in nigeria and abroad ,Omotola Jalade, Charly boy,Kefee ,Sharon Rose and many more that has been concealed due contractual agreements. |

The most creative musician in recent times in the Nigerian music industry. His cocktail of genres from western world R&B and Rap To traditional Highlife music and Juju music is responsible for his unmatchable uniqueness.
While studying Engineering in College of Technology Paul doubled as a producer, songwriter before hitting the limelight. Born to a great Nigerian music legend, Late I.K. Dairo M.B.E., who was the only musician to be honoured by QUEEN ELIZABETH II in Africa in the sixties, Paul Babatunde Dairo is unquestionably, a chip of the old block. His first album titled "Dairo Music Foundation Project" in 1999 featuring hit singles like; Mosorire Happy Day and Yes O! . The Album remains a timeless classic, popular amongst Nigerians and Africans in Diaspora. The album has sold over two million copies and is still selling till date. The album became a delight for entertainment reporters, and music journalist. Which fetched Paul Play Dairo most of the Nigerian music and entertainment industry awards including the MNET WHERE U AT AWARDS FOR MALE ARTISTE OF THE YEAR .
The president of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, CHIEF OLUSEGUN OBASANJO is a great fan of Paul Play. He has also performed with international acts like JOE, SEAN PAUL,EVE,DONELL JONES,KENNY LATIMORE, DAVID LYNDEN HALL and 112 just to mention a few. He has released four albums till date and his last R&B album HITSVILLE is a tremendous success winning eight awards and seventeen nominations in 2007,this album fetched him the ALBUM OF THE YEAR, RECORD OF THE YEAR, ARTISTE OF THE YEAR AND R&B ALBUM OF THE YEAR at the HIP HOP WORLD AWARDS 2007. He also carted away most of the AMEN 2007 awards with BEST VOCALIST OF THE YEAR,BEST R&B VOCALS OF THE YEAR, BEST R&B ALBUM OF THE YEAR and BEST R&B SONG OF THE YEAR.
Paul Play Dairo is a role model to many Nigerian youths at home and abroad. HE runs his own independent music label to search for young talents and impact positively in their lives and to further in the development of the music industry.From the remote areas of the villages to the corridors of Aso rock, Paul Play Dairo is a household name. |
